A video of Eynsham firefighters taking on the mannequin challenge at what appears to be a crash scene has been viewed more than 100,000 times. 

The clip shows the crew joining in with the craze - which sees people standing still for the duration of a video - while seemingly attending to a head-on collision between two vehicles. 

A man's head is being held by a firefighter while other men work at the scene. 

But the team at Eynsham Fire Station revealed they had staged the video to highlight the dangers of using mobile phones while driving. 

The crew said it was still seeing drivers using mobile phones despite warning and wanted to share the video with as many people as possible to show the dangers.
